From: EMS mutagenesis in mature seed-derived rice calli as a new method for rapidly obtaining TILLING mutant populations

Figure 2

Plantlets regeneration of Oryza sativa var. Hispagram from EMS mutagenised calli. (a) Oryza sativa cv. Hispagran dehusked seeds forming callus masses after 18 days culture in darkness using N6 medium supplemented with 0.5 mg L-1 casaminoacids, 1 g L-1 L-proline, 2 mg L-1 2,4 dichlorophenoxyacetic acid and 0.5 g L-1 2-(N-morpholino) ethane sulphonic acid. (b)  development of a scutellum-derived callus mass (black arrow) and a callus mass growing from radicle (black circle), (c) and (d) plantlet regeneration from mature seed-derived callus (0.2% EMS mutagenised) in MS medium supplemented with 1 g L-1 casein hydrolisate, 3 mg L-1 kinetin, 0.5 mg L-1  6-benzylaminopurin, 0.5 mg L-1 1-naphtalenacetic acid and 0.5 g L-1 2-(N-morpholino) ethane sulphonic acid under 18/6 h light/dark cycles (details in Methods). Scale bar 1 cm.
